ChatGPT: 人工智能技术驱动的革命性应用探索
引言:技术跃迁下的自然语言处理革命
在人工智能发展史上,自然语言处理(NLP)长期面临两大核心挑战:语义理解的深度与上下文关联的准确性。传统模型受限于规则驱动和统计学习框架,难以处理模糊表达、隐喻修辞及长程依赖问题。2022年OpenAI推出的ChatGPT(基于GPT-3.5/4架构)通过自回归生成式预训练与人类反馈强化学习(RLHF)的融合,首次实现了接近人类水平的自然语言交互能力,标志着NLP技术从”理解文本”向”创造对话”的范式转变。
一、技术突破:ChatGPT的核心创新点
1.1 预训练-微调架构的范式革新
ChatGPT采用Transformer解码器结构,通过海量文本数据(45TB)的无监督预训练,掌握语言概率分布规律。其创新点在于:
- 上下文窗口扩展:GPT-4将上下文长度提升至32K tokens,支持长文档处理
- 多模态融合:支持文本、图像、代码的跨模态理解(如GPT-4V)
- 稀疏注意力机制:降低计算复杂度,提升推理效率
# 示例:使用Hugging Face Transformers库调用ChatGPT APIfrom transformers import AutoModelForCausalLM, AutoTokenizermodel = AutoModelForCausalLM.from_pretrained("gpt2") # 简化示例,实际需API密钥tokenizer = AutoTokenizer.from_pretrained("gpt2")input_text = "解释Transformer架构的核心创新"inputs = tokenizer(input_text, return_tensors="pt")outputs = model.generate(**inputs, max_length=100)print(tokenizer.decode(outputs[0]))
1.2 强化学习驱动的交互优化
RLHF技术通过三阶段训练实现对话质量跃升:
- 监督微调(SFT):人工标注优质对话数据
- 奖励模型训练:对比不同回复的偏好度
- 近端策略优化(PPO):根据奖励信号调整生成策略
实验数据显示,RLHF使ChatGPT的回答安全性提升67%,事实准确性提高42%(OpenAI技术报告,2023)。
二、应用场景:从实验室到产业化的跨越
2.1 智能客服系统的重构
传统客服系统依赖关键词匹配和预设话术,ChatGPT通过以下能力实现升级:
- 多轮对话管理:动态追踪用户意图变化
- 情绪感知回应:识别用户情绪并调整回复语气
- 跨领域知识迁移:无缝处理技术咨询与售后问题
某电商平台接入ChatGPT后,客户满意度提升31%,平均处理时长缩短45%。
2.2 代码生成与调试的范式转变
GitHub Copilot等工具基于ChatGPT架构,实现:
- 自然语言转代码:支持30+种编程语言
- 实时错误检测:在IDE中提示潜在bug
- 代码优化建议:提供性能改进方案
// 用户输入自然语言需求// "用Java实现快速排序,并添加时间复杂度注释"// ChatGPT生成代码示例public class QuickSort {public static void quickSort(int[] arr, int low, int high) {if (low < high) {int pi = partition(arr, low, high); // O(n)quickSort(arr, low, pi-1); // T(n/2)quickSort(arr, pi+1, high); // T(n/2)}}// 平均时间复杂度:O(n log n)}
2.3 教育领域的个性化创新
ChatGPT在教育场景的应用包括:
- 自适应学习系统:根据学生水平动态调整题目难度
- 智能作文批改:从语法、逻辑、创意多维度评分
- 虚拟学习伙伴:模拟历史人物进行对话式教学
斯坦福大学实验表明,使用ChatGPT辅助学习的学生,知识留存率比传统方式高28%。
三、开发实践:构建ChatGPT应用的完整指南
3.1 API调用与参数优化
OpenAI提供两种调用方式:
# 方式1:直接调用ChatCompletionimport openaiopenai.api_key = "YOUR_API_KEY"response = openai.ChatCompletion.create(model="gpt-4",messages=[{"role": "user", "content": "解释量子计算原理"}],temperature=0.7, # 控制创造性max_tokens=200)print(response['choices'][0]['message']['content'])# 方式2:使用Assistant API(更精细控制)
关键参数说明:
temperature:0.1(确定性)~1.0(创造性)top_p:核采样阈值(0.8~0.95推荐)frequency_penalty:降低重复性(-2.0~2.0)
3.2 私有化部署方案
对于数据敏感场景,可考虑:
- 本地化微调:使用LoRA(低秩适应)技术减少计算资源
- 边缘设备部署:通过GPTQ量化将模型压缩至1/4大小
- 混合云架构:敏感数据在私有云处理,通用任务调用公有API
3.3 伦理与安全实践
实施以下措施降低风险:
- 内容过滤:集成NSFW(非安全内容)检测模型
- 用户认证:限制高风险功能的访问权限
- 审计日志:记录所有AI生成内容
四、未来展望:技术演进与应用边界
4.1 技术发展趋势
- 多模态大模型:文本、图像、视频的统一表征学习
- 实时交互优化:降低延迟至100ms以内
- 自主代理系统:结合规划算法实现任务自动化
4.2 社会影响与挑战
- 就业结构变革:预计到2025年,15%的客服岗位将被AI替代
- 数据隐私争议:需建立全球统一的数据治理框架
- 算法偏见治理:持续完善公平性评估指标
结语:重新定义人机协作边界
ChatGPT的出现标志着人工智能从”工具”向”协作者”的转变。其价值不仅在于技术突破,更在于开创了自然语言作为人机交互通用界面的新纪元。对于开发者而言,掌握ChatGPT应用开发将成为未来十年最重要的技术能力之一。建议从业者:
- 深入理解Transformer架构原理
- 实践API调用与微调技术
- 关注伦理规范与安全实践
- 探索垂直领域的创新应用
在这个AI重塑世界的时代,ChatGPT既是技术革命的产物,也是推动更多革命的引擎。如何驾驭这股力量,将决定我们在智能时代的竞争力。